## Authentication

Since the v4 payroll export moved from fixed-width files to the Ledgerline JSON schema, all export jobs authenticate against the internal Stubfeed service rather than the legacy FTP drop. Rotate credentials quarterly and update the scheduler config in tandem. The export worker reads its credential from the environment at startup, using the key below.

service key, fawip-bajef: kto11_Qt5wZK9vdNC

MEMO — Branch Managers

Quick heads-up: we're kicking off a second-source search for the gasket housings we currently get only from Varnholt Castings. Delays out of their Brennick plant have stung us twice this quarter. Marta Quillen is leading vendor screening and will ping you for regional input. Keep this under your hats for now — context below.

confidential, yawif-fadup: The southern region missed its Eliius quota by 61.1 percent last quarter. Istixax Freight plans to raise the Jorwyn list price by 65.7 percent in October. The board signed off on a budget of $445.3 million for Project Ulaox. The renewal with Briathax Partners closes at $41.0 million a year, 49.9 percent below the last contract.

**Q: How do I retry a failed export from the Quillmere plugin API?**

Failed exports are held in the Varnick retry queue for 72 hours. Your plugin should poll the status endpoint with exponential backoff, never faster than once per minute. If the queue itself is locked after repeated failures, unlock it with the recovery passphrase that appears below.

vault phrase of tajeg-tageg = pelix-druix-holius-briael-zorwyn-frawyn-fraox-norok-drueth-aldiel

## Prunebot: stale-branch cleanup

Prunebot deletes branches with no commits in 90 days. If a customer reports a missing branch, check the Prunebot audit log first — restores are possible within 30 days. To query the audit endpoint or trigger a restore, authenticate against the Prunebot internal API with the key below.

gateway credential: kto3_qfe

## Ticket FV-218: Staging env misconfigured for FeedProof validator

Welcome aboard — this one is a good first task. The FeedProof podcast validator in staging keeps rejecting valid feeds because its env file was copied from the old Harrowell box and still points at the retired schema mirror. Please set SCHEMA_MIRROR_URL to the current mirror and confirm VALIDATOR_TIMEOUT is 30, not 3. The fetcher also needs its access credential restored; append it directly after this line:

secret setting of yajog-taguf: ARCHIVE_KEY3=051